Transaction 085900462679551812e19bc85c1128aea4172d015359dc58e5469ec15e4293e4

2 Input
1 Outputs
  • 085900462679551812e19bc85c1128aea4172d015359dc58e5469ec15e4293e4:0
  • value  152017
    address  1Fk9pWToCYDYxn8PpykgMP1PFHULeyGs95